The Vikings have officially named Kyler Murray their starting quarterback, with J.J. McCarthy stepping into the backup role — a move that signals optimism for Minnesota despite McCarthy’s injury history and Murray’s uncertain comeback. Meanwhile, Fever coach Stephanie White defiantly defended her handling of DiJonai Carrington’s controversial foul, rejecting fan criticism and emphasizing unity in the league. In the NFL, joint practices sparked drama: A.J. Brown outmaneuvered Sauce Gardner, igniting a fiery response, while Jets cornerback Qwan’tez Stiggers was hospitalized after collapsing during drills — though he’s now conscious and talking. College football sees Notre Dame atop preseason rankings thanks to CJ Carr, followed by Georgia, Ohio State, and Miami — showcasing a fiercely competitive playoff landscape. In basketball, Texas Tech emerges as a major winner in the transfer portal, adding key fifth-year players including Darrion Williams, while Gonzaga and Tennessee also bolstered rosters for a strong push ahead.
